Position Summary

The Biological Sciences Program at Michigan State University invites applications for a biology education research Postdoctoral Research Associate in developing a curriculum that explicitly supports connections across introductory biology courses. The Research Associate will join a diverse group of educators and discipline-based education researchers working to improve connections between courses in an introductory undergraduate biology curriculum. These courses are focused on supporting three-dimensional learning using evidence-based teaching approaches and are taught by instructional teams made up of faculty, graduate teaching assistants, and undergraduate learning assistants.

Primary Responsibilities include: 1) Collecting and analyzing data to increase understand how students connect structure-properties-function, biological information flow, and evolution when creating mechanistic explanations of phenomena that span introductory biology courses and the instructional strategies that support these connections. 2) Collaborating with BioSci faculty to use research and course assessment data to iteratively improve instructional materials that support students in building connections across BioSci courses. 3) Supporting teaching in BioSci courses through mentored teaching experiences.
